Northwest Center for Behavioral Health, Fort Supply

We are seeking dedicated Mental Health Technicians to join our team and support patients of behavioral health treatment in an inpatient setting. Under close supervision, this position will play an integral role in providing direct and indirect care to individuals in need of behavioral health support.

Position Overview

As a Mental Health Technician, you will assist in creating a safe, supportive environment for patients, ensuring that they receive the care they need while engaging in therapeutic activities. You will be instrumental in promoting wellness and safety, helping to de‑escalate difficult situations, and providing guidance as a role model for patients.

Hourly pay rate:
Level I - $15.10, Level II - $16.28, Level III - $17.59 (this includes a $1.00/hour differential when working in a direct care setting!)

Additional $0.50/hr shift differential when working evening or nights and $0.75/hr shift differential for working weekends and holidays!

A Level I MHT working a holiday weekend night could earn $17.10/hr - with differentials that stack!

Minimum Qualifications and Experience
  • Must possess a strong commitment to patient well‑being and safety
  • Must believe that recovery is possible!

Preference may be given to CNA certification.

Level II requires one year of experience providing patient care, and Level III requires two years of experience providing patient care.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ide Direct and Indirect Care:
    Assist in the care of patients in a behavioral health setting, both individually and in groups
  • Ensure Safety and Well‑Being:
    Participate in de‑escalation efforts, ensuring that patients are kept safe and their needs are met
  • Role Model:
    Demonstrate effective problem‑solving, decision‑making, and coping skills to consumers
  • Assist with Therapeutic

    Activities:

    Help facilitate recreational and therapeutic activities designed to promote mental and emotional well‑being
